Default how hard to put in shorty header on a 05 dakota 4.7l

I'm trying to decide whether I should go a head and bu a jba shorty header and cat back exhaust. But I won't do it if I have to pay a shop. I've installed cat back systems but never a exhaust header.

Depends on your skill level and tool selection. It's basically unbolting the stock headers from the engine and down pipes and installing the new ones. Problems arise when you snap off manifold bolts. Everything is no doubt rusty and been through many, many heat/cool cycles so it's going to be a pia to remove. Use lots of penetrating oil over the course of a few days. Might make it easier.
